Srikanth Akkiraju Appointed Chief Transformation Officer at ServiceNow

Srikanth Akkiraju has been appointed as Chief Transformation Officer at ServiceNow. In this role, he will partner with global enterprises to lead large-scale transformation initiatives, with a focus on AI-driven customer engagement and enabling organizations to transition into agentic enterprises.

His mandate includes reimagining operating models, aligning leadership priorities, and building capabilities that sustain long-term transformation. The appointment reflects the growing importance of integrating AI into enterprise workflows while driving holistic organizational change.

Srikanth joins ServiceNow with extensive leadership experience from Philips, where he held several senior roles including Global Chief Information Officer (Commercial) and Global Chief Digital & Information Officer for Healthcare Informatics. During his tenure, he led large-scale digital initiatives and played a key role in advancing data-driven transformation across the organization.

With deep expertise in digital transformation, enterprise IT, data, and analytics, along with a strong track record of driving innovation and organizational change, Akkiraju is well positioned to lead transformation initiatives at a global scale.
